Milk spoils school meals

Posted in:
Milk came out spoiled from milk cartons at Elgin ISD, which has been addressed by the district.

Students were recently given spoiled milk after the school's supplier reportedly had issues with a packer.Parents sparked concern over the situation after hearing from students about the bad dairy.
